“Life with Mailer,” a biographical article by James Atlas in the New York Times Magazine (9 September 1979), with a cover photograph of Mailer — the longest biographical essay on him since Brock Brower’s 1965 Life piece (65.20). Like Brower, Atlas concentrates on whether Mailer will make good on his early promise to write “the great American novel”; Mailer’s family and friends are quoted.
